My Lilac does not flower, HELP! 1) Lilac that are purchased bare root or balled may flower the 1st year then not for 3-5 years after. Better to buy a plant in a container, these will have a complete root system and flower at a younger age. 2) Remember, lilac need at least 6 hours of sun a day. Possibly the location is hampering blooms. 3) Too much nitrogen. When planted in a lawn (lawns need lots of nitrogen) but in lilac this only produces green not flowers. 4) Pruning the wrong way.
